FloristWare helps florists streamline and automate the time-consuming and repetitive tasks in running a retail flower shop. Powerful delivery management/route optimization features help them deliver more flowers orders with less gas and fewer drivers. A mobile floral delivery app helps those drivers and allows you to send real time delivery confirmations – with photo, video and signature capture – by email and/or text message. FloristWare also integrates with the most popular e-commerce websites for florists including those from Flower Shop Network and Shopify.

What's the story behind your product?

FloristWare's answer:

FloristWare was first created in the early 2000's for use by a high-volume family owned flower shop that was not willing to pay the $20K plus that was charged by other floral-specific POS systems at the time. It was released to the public in 2005 and was the first floral POS system to use a pay-as-you-go SAAS model with no contracts, commitments or big up-front payment.

Since then FloristWare has worked with hundreds of real local florists and been a strong supporter of the retail floral industry and member off organizations like SAF (the Society of American Florists), GLFA (Great Lake Floral Association) and AIFD (American Institute of Floral Designers).

What makes your product unique?

FloristWare's answer:

FloristWare offers the kind of quality and support associated with wire service systems that cost many times more. It also focusses on doing one thing (Floral POS) really well and providing tight integrations with the best websites, merchant service providers, etc. Most other floral-specific POS systems try and lock the florist into their POS, their website, their expensive credit card processing etc.

The Best Online Flower Delivery Services That Deliver Nationwide
Founded in 2011, BloomNation prides itself on local flower delivery with access to thousands of florists across the U.S. Shop by city to see the florists and designs available in your area. Each bouquet is personally hand-delivered by the locals, and they set their own delivery fees.
